scorch in Czech is ožeh, ožehnutí, sežehnutí — scorch means to burn the surface of something, discolouring or damaging it without destroying it completely.
scorch in Czech
ožeh
A slight or surface burn.
ožehnutí
A slight or surface burn.
sežehnutí
A slight or surface burn.
ožehnout
(transitive) To burn the surface of something so as to discolour it
sežehnout
(transitive) To burn the surface of something so as to discolour it
spálit
řítit se
(intransitive) To move at high speed (so as to leave scorch marks on the ground, physically or figuratively).
What does "scorch" mean?
-
verb To burn the surface of something, discolouring or damaging it without destroying it completely.
"The iron scorched a mark into the shirt."
-
noun A mark or patch of surface burning or discolouration.
"There's a scorch on the tablecloth from the hot pan."
